The Human Development Index (HDI) of Central Java in 2021 is 72.16, growing 0.40 percent (an increase of 0.29 points)

Abstract

  • The increase in Central Java's HDI in 2021 is supported by an increase in all its constituent components. In 2020 the COVID-19 pandemic caused a slowdown in HDI growth caused by a decline in adjusted per capita spending. In 2021, per capita spending has crawled up 0.95 percent compared to 2020
  • In terms of education, children in Central Java who are 7 years old in 2021, have the hope of enjoying education for 12.77 years, this figure is an increase of 0.07 years compared to 2020 which reached 12.70 years. In addition, the average length of schooling for residents aged 25 years and over increased by 0.06 years, to 7.75 years in 2021.
  • In terms of health, babies in Central Java born in 2021 have a life expectancy of up to 74.47 years, 0.10 years longer than those born in the previous year.
